What do you get to do in this position?

  • Be a part of an energetic and vibrant team in a growing business unit.
  • Prepare technical audit reports of existing electrical infrastructure.
  • Prepare electrical systems plans, specifications, and study reports to accomplish the goals and objectives of the projects. Electrical Systems include power generation and distribution, lighting, fire alarm, lightning protection and low­voltage systems
  • Perform field investigation, as required.
  • Assist or lead construction administration for projects, as assigned.
  • Develop and maintain project plan to ensure scope, schedule, and budget correspond with team expectations.
  • Develop and maintain positive relationships with internal and external clients. 
  • Contribute to strategizing the sale of a project and assisting in sales presentations

Required Qualifications

  • Four-year accredited engineering degree
  • 5 years relevant work experience
  • Engineer In Training (EIT) certificate
  • Advanced understanding of the operation and energy use of electrical building systems including power generation and distribution, and lighting.
  • Familiarity with fire alarm, lightning protection and low­voltage systems.
  • Experience in developing conceptual and construction documents for building electrical systems.
  • Professional verbal and written communication skills including, but not limited to, the ability to listen effectively and solicit input from others
  • Intermediate ability to use Microsoft Office programs
  • Thorough understanding of NFPA 70, National Electric Code and code-dictated sizing and design standards.
  • Familiarity with NFPA 72 - National Fire Alarm and Signal Code,
  • Thorough understanding of International Building Council codes relevant to electrical systems, and IES standards and guidelines
  • Organizational skills including, but not limited to, the ability to handle multiple demands and assignments, and the ability to prioritize tasks effectively and efficiently

Preferred Qualifications 

  • Professional Engineer (P.E.) License
  • Familiarity with solar PV design, EV charging design, and water / waste water systems.

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the primary duties of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the primary duties.

The majority of the work is sedentary. However, when performing job site visits, the employee will encounter: moving over rough or uneven surfaces; recurring bending, crouching, stooping, stretching, reaching, or similar activities; recurring lifting of moderately heavy to light items. Transporting of items such as laptop computers, tools, ladders and other heavy equipment; driving an automobile, etc.

While performing the primary functions of the job, the employee is regularly exposed a general office environment. During periods of project site visits, the employee will be exposed to outside weather conditions as well as mechanical equipment rooms which could consist of confined spaces and loud noises. Employee may work in different environments while on various job sites. This job will require approximately 20%-30% travel to project sites. Travel will occur through the use of an automobile or by airplane to destinations.
